Out-of-state part-time undergraduates at UofL paid an average of $1,180 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$499 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$11,966 | $28,312 |
Fees | $196 | $196 |
Books and Supplies | $1,200 | $1,200 |
On Campus Room and Board | $9,754 | $9,754 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$6,562 | $6,562 |

You may also want to consider how much in student loans you’ll need when thinking about the overall cost to attend a school. Students who received their bachelor’s degree at UofL in ME walked away with an average of $24,148 in student debt. That is 5% higher than the national average of $22,913.
The median early career salary of ME students who receive their bachelor’s degree from UofL is $65,956 per year. That is 7% higher than the national average of $61,915.

About 11.7% of the students who received their BS in ME in 2019-2020 were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 16.3%.
Around 13.3% of ME bachelor’s degree recipients at UofL in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 28%.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 4 |
Black or African American | 3 |
Hispanic or Latino | 6 |
Native American or Alaska Native | 0 |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 0 |
White | 111 |
International Students | 0 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 4 |
